WebTexas Department of Public Safety WebDriver-trainees who are not native English speakers must be instructed in FMCSA English language proficiency requirements and the consequences for violations. The training providers must teach driver-trainees the implications of violating Federal and state regulations will have on their driving records and their employing motor carrier's records. WebAge, Language, Residency, & Education Requirements for CDL Drivers. The FMCSA requires in its regulations minimum age, U.S. residency status, and English language proficiency requirements that all commercial motor vehicle operators must adhere to. Each state, in addition, may have their own specific length-of-residency or licensing minimums.
